Foremost Clean Energy Announces Upcoming Ground-Based Gravity Survey at its Hatchet Lake Uranium Project, Athabasca Basin, Saskatchewan
Globenewswire· 2025-12-04 13:30
Core Viewpoint - Foremost Clean Energy Ltd. is initiating a ground-based gravity survey at its Hatchet Lake Uranium Property to refine geological models and enhance future drilling programs [1][3]. Survey Details - The gravity survey will consist of approximately 788 gravity stations, collected at 100-meter intervals on 200-meter line spacing, focusing on priority structural corridors along the southeast extension of the Richardson Trend [4]. - The survey aims to identify gravity lows and gradients associated with hydrothermal alteration halos and fault-controlled fluid pathways, prioritizing gravity anomalies that overlap with graphitic shear zones and geochemical anomalies for drill testing [7]. Richardson Trend - The Hatchet Lake Project encompasses a significant portion of the Richardson Trend, which is known for hosting uranium mineralization and has over 6 km of under-tested conductor strike length [6]. - The structural setting of the Richardson Trend is similar to other major uranium systems in the eastern Basin margin, such as the La Rocque Corridor, which hosts notable deposits [6]. Historical Context - Previous drilling along the Richardson Trend by Denison Mines Corp. revealed multiple uranium-bearing intervals, with significant results including 1.52% U₃O₈ over 0.15 m and 0.45% U₃O₈ over 2.3 m [10][7]. - The results from the gravity survey are expected to directly influence the upcoming winter 2026 drill program, ensuring a focused and data-driven approach [3][8]. Foremost Clean Energy Receives 3-Year Exploration Permit and Announces Gravity Survey at Turkey Lake Uranium Project, Athabasca Basin, Saskatchewan
Globenewswire· 2025-12-01 13:00
Core Viewpoint - Foremost Clean Energy Ltd. has received a three-year exploration permit for its Turkey Lake Uranium Project, allowing for extensive exploration activities, including a ground-based gravity survey set to begin in December 2025, aimed at refining drill targets for a planned 2026 drilling program [1][2][3]. Exploration Permit and Project Overview - The Saskatchewan Ministry of Environment has issued a three-year exploration permit for the Turkey Lake Uranium Project, valid until December 31, 2028, permitting up to 75 drill holes and related exploration activities [1]. - The Turkey Lake Property spans 9,363 acres (3,789 hectares) and is strategically located along the eastern edge of the Athabasca Basin, featuring shallow unconformity depths of less than 50 meters and a 10-kilometer conductor system that remains largely untested [7][8]. Gravity Survey Details - A ground-based gravity survey will commence in December, consisting of approximately 1,312 stations collected at 100-meter intervals across a priority NE-trending conductive corridor [4][6]. - The survey aims to identify gravity lows associated with hydrothermal alteration and to map fault-controlled fluid pathways, enhancing the geological model for future drilling [6][13]. Historical Context and Mineralization - Historical exploration by Gulf Minerals, Cameco, and Denison between 1978 and 2010 has identified multiple zones of unconformity-associated uranium mineralization at Turkey Lake, including notable intercepts of 0.16% U₃O₈ over 0.6 meters and 0.12% U₃O₈ over 0.5 meters [3][12][8]. - The results from past drilling confirm a fertile uranium-bearing fluid system along the Turkey Lake conductive corridor, indicating significant basement potential that remains largely untested [8]. Future Plans - The results from the gravity survey will be integrated with existing datasets to prioritize drill targets for the projected 2026 drill program, focusing on both unconformity and basement-hosted uranium targets [13].
